Abstract

The Socialization of Financial Literacy and Safe Investment in the Banjarejo Village Community of Madiun City aims to provide a deeper understanding to the Banjarejo Village community of Madiun City, especially vulnerable groups such as MSMEs, housewives, and the younger generation about the importance of managing finances wisely and investing safely. This program also provides education on choosing financial products that are legal and supervised by relevant authorities, such as the Financial Services Authority (OJK). This socialization activity is part of the community service activities in the Banjarejo Village of Madiun City. Implementation by conducting an initial survey and interviews with the local community to identify their level of financial literacy, their needs related to financial education, and common investment patterns. The activity was carried out in the Banjarejo Village of Madiun City on January 19, 2025, and was attended by 27 participants. As a result, most of the participants showed a fairly good understanding of personal budget management.
